
Afghanistan: Kabul evacuations in final phase
US-led evacuations from Kabul airport enter final stage following the two bomb attacks.
Evacuation efforts are continuing at Kabul airport following yesterday's bomb attacks that killed at least 90 people and injured more than 150. Hospitals in Kabul, already struggling with fewer staff since the Taliban took power a week ago, have been overwhelmed with patients. We'll bring you the latest from the city and across Afghanistan.
Also, we'll speak to the woman who led a flag protest in defiance of Taliban forces who had just taken over Kabul. The protest raised the Afghan national flag on the country's independence day, pictures of this young woman protesting were shared around the world.
